As of May 18, 2026, Stoneybrook Apartments in West College Corner, Indiana, is offering 32 units approved for Low Income Housing. This affordable housing development provides options with rents varying between $188 and $448. Eligibility is based on meeting the income threshold and other criteria.
*Rent estimates are calculated using Union County Fair Market Rents for 2026 and assume the 30% extremely low income threshold is met. This means that the tenant will be responsible for 30% of the Fair Market Rent for this unit. It is recommended to contact the for exact rent pricing.
